Varun Dhawan: Doing historical films a double-edged sword
Updated On: 12 June, 2018 02:57 PM IST | | PTI
Historical films have always been a tricky subject for Bollywood filmmakers and most recently Sanjay Leela Bhansali faced a lot of trouble before the release of his film Padmaavat

Varun Dhawan
Actor Varun Dhawan believes making historical films in the country is a double-edged sword as everyone is offended with everything nowadays. Varun launched author Amish Tripathi's first book in Indic Chronicle series - Suheldev and The Battle Of Bahraich.
Asked whether actors were wary of choosing historical films, Varun told reporters, "Unfortunately, this is a double-edged sword in our country. Certain sections become upset or they say, 'We were not consulted before this happened'," he said.
The actor said Amish, who has written book on Shiva and Ram, told him that he never faced any trouble over his interpretation.
